How to treat polio

Polio is an acute infectious disease caused by the polio virus that can seriously endanger physical health. Polio patients must always take various active measures in the acute phase, recovery phase, and sequelae phase to protect nerve cells from damage, reduce muscle atrophy, and prevent the occurrence and development of deformities. So how to treat polio? The treatment options available to polio patients are as follows.

1. Physical therapy: such as ultrashort wave, drug ion introduction, sunbathing, infrared, hot compress, electrical stimulation therapy, massage, acupuncture, acupoint injection, catgut implantation, hyperbaric oxygen, etc.

2. Drug treatment: such as galantamine, vitamin B1, vitamin B2, methoxazole, ATP and blood dilator injection drugs. Traditional Chinese medicine includes Sancai Decoction, Buyang Huanwu Decoction, etc.

3. Medical sports training: According to the location and degree of paralysis of the patient, special medical gymnastics, passive exercise (for patients with muscle strength level 0-1), assisted exercise (for patients with muscle strength level 2-3), active exercise (for patients with muscle strength above level 3) are performed. Resistance exercise can also be used.

4. Surgical treatment: Indications: patients should be over 5 years old and be able to cooperate with doctors in examination and functional training; the course of the disease should generally be more than 2 years after the onset of the disease, but some patients (soft tissue surgery) can be treated earlier. Contraindications: patients with balanced muscle paralysis without deformity; patients with mild muscle paralysis, muscle strength above level 4 or mild limb deformity that does not affect function or shortening within 2 cm; patients with extensive muscle paralysis accompanied by multiple severe deformities, flail legs. Surgical methods include muscle transfer, tendon lengthening or release, joint fusion, pelvic osteotomy, diaphysis lengthening, epiphysis lengthening, spinal correction, etc.
